About this program

The State University of New York at Fredonia is a comprehensive liberal arts campus in Fredonia, New York — a small college town on Lake Erie in western New York — with an overall acceptance rate of 85%. SUNY Fredonia has the most comprehensive selection of theatrical degree programmes in the SUNY system, offering BFA degrees in Acting, Dance, Musical Theatre, and Theatrical Production & Design, a BA in Theatre Arts, and a BS in Dance. The Department is fully NAST-accredited. The Michael C. Rockefeller Arts Center (RAC) recently underwent a major renovation and expansion, including a 60,000-square-foot studio wing added in 2016. The RAC is consistently listed as one of the 25 most amazing college theatre complexes in the United States, and houses four performance spaces: the 1,200-seat Harry King Concert Hall, the 360-seat Robert W. Marvel Theatre, the 150-seat Alice E. Bartlett Theatre, and the 100-seat Merrins Studio Theatre. Students have access to four acting studios, four dance studios, a costume shop, scene shop, light and sound lab, drawing and drafting lab, and computer-aided drafting lab.
